Realizing she had set aside her spirituality after a major breakup, author Tatiana Jerome began asking questions many women ask when sweeping up the shards of a broken relationship: Why do I experience the same thing over and again with this man? Am I the problem? What needs to be done differently? Will I ever have a better, more uplifting and supportive partnership? Tatiana began using social media as a direct way to uplift and empower herself. It was her way of holding herself accountable and reminding herself of her importance. Many of her writings were shared throughout social media and became a force of its own, empowering women to the point where her social media pages have become a safe haven for women who look for a daily pick me up. Her words have spread quickly with hundreds of thousands of women who share her messages with others and encourage their friends to follow her as well. Love Lost, Love Found is a woman-to-woman conversation that nurtures each hurting woman over her breakup but also empowers them to hold themselves accountable and to move forward toward more fulfilling and lasting love. Women learn why and how to let go of the past, find love within themselves, and welcome new love into their lives. How? By implementing the action plan, by not doing things on what Tatiana calls ?the drop list, by attending to her physical well-being, and by doing the spiritual checkups. Each woman, whether college age, career-driven, single parent, or newly divorced woman can live an extraordinary life and attract her new love.
